Methylboronic acid MIDA ester
Methylboronic acid MIDA ester (CAS: 1104637-40-2, C6H10BNO4) is a key organometallic reagent used in chemical synthesis. With a molecular weight of 170.96 g/mol, this compound belongs to the MIDA boronate family. It serves as a valuable building block in organic chemistry, facilitating the construction of complex molecules through various coupling reactions. Its stability and reactivity profile make it a preferred choice for advanced synthetic methodologies.

Organic Synthesis
Methylboronic acid MIDA ester is widely employed as a versatile building block in complex organic synthesis. It is particularly useful in Suzuki-Miyaura cross-coupling reactions for the formation of carbon-carbon bonds.
Medicinal Chemistry
This compound serves as an intermediate in the synthesis of novel pharmaceutical agents. Its structure allows for the introduction of methyl groups and boronic acid functionalities into drug candidates.
Materials Science
It can be utilised in the development of new materials, including polymers and organic electronic components, where precise molecular architecture is crucial for desired properties.
